Russia: The top Russian admiral, presumed dead, “appeared in a teleconference.”

Video footage of the commander of the Russian Black Sea Fleet, Admiral Viktor Sokolov, participating in a video conference was released by the Russian Ministry of Defense. This comes one day after Ukrainian special forces claimed to have killed him.

In a photo released by the Russian Ministry of Defense, Sokolov appeared to be taking part in a video conference with Defense Minister Sergei Shoigu and other high-ranking naval and army officers.

Ukrainian special forces had claimed on Monday that they killed Sokolov, along with 33 other officers, with a missile strike last week at the headquarters of the Russian Black Sea Fleet in the port of Sevastopol.

Earlier today, the Kremlin stated that there was no information regarding the Ukrainian claims of Sokolov’s death. Dmitry Peskov, the Kremlin’s spokesperson, said, “There is no information on this matter from the Ministry of Defense.”
